    Drop the per dungeon apexis/currency of choice down 1000 is too high per completion. Maybe 200-250, probably less if they're chainable.
    The gating should be on the LFR equivalent gear drops, not the game play. Don't make it 100% (or it WOULD pull people form LFR cause it'd be guaranteed) and they come from a bag which you can only get 7 of per week. That bag can also contain other listed rewards.
    Remove Follower contracts as a possible reward. Those are hard to obtain for a reason.
    Add back in factional reputation gains but keep it slow. No 'catch up' 250, 500, 1000 rep tokens from dungeons or dungeon currency.

    I'd love to see a dungeon patch with the same level of quality as patch 3.3 (The Frozen Halls WotLK patch). Why not add another battered hilt item to give incentive to run new dungeons, even if you out-gear them? There are actually a lot of ways they could encourage players to do dungeons without making LFR irrelevant. Mounts are one of them. Cosmetics, pets, titles, the list goes on... I also want to see dungeons with major lore characters. I'll take anything but the same old uninteresting pinata dungeons we've had since the start of MoP three years ago.
